WebThe park is home to iconic landmarks including the Cape May Lighthouse, Fire Control Tower 23, and Battery 223 (aka “the bunker”), the remains of a harbor defense battery from World War II. The park is free to the public, an ideal location for birding, picnics, painting, photography, and nature walks. Explore ponds, coastal dunes, marshes ... WebComing May 2024. Cape May: With an ascent of 42 ft, Higbee Beach Loop Trail has the most elevation gain of all of the bird watching trails in the area. The next highest ascent for bird watching trails is Garrett Family Preserve Trail with 22 ft of elevation gain. east and western hemisphereWebCape May County has a tremendous variety of habitats for migrating birds: salt marshes, swamp or wet woods, fresh water marshes and ponds, pine forest, saltwater, grasslands … c \\u0026 w fish company inc v fox case bried
